Bewerben locations Ontario, CA, United States time type Full time posted on Gestern ausgeschrieben job requisition id JR-0075888 The Electro-Mechanical Technician Level 4 is responsible for the day-to-day troubleshooting and preventative/predictive maintenance on the conveyor and sorter. Acts as a senior material handling technician on all equipment installed at the Ontario, CA site location. Aids and mentors lower-level employees. 1 day shift and 1 2nd shift opening working Sunday - Friday; 4:30 pm - 1:00 am. Overtime and occasional weekend work may be required.

What You Will Do in This Role
  • Repair and maintain Material Handling Equipment (MHE), ensuring accurate belt tracking, component adjustments/replacements, and accurate lubrication.
  • Complete preventative maintenance routines, documentation, and procedures to maintain equipment at efficient performance.
  • Apply electrical test equipment to troubleshoot electrical circuitry and ensure flawless operations.
  • Build and close work orders in the asset management system, accurately recording data such as labor hours, equipment maintenance, and parts used.
  • Troubleshoot conveyance problems, determine necessary resources, and successfully implement solutions.
  • Locate and manage spare parts inventory to ensure timely repairs.
  • Perform complex maintenance and equipment testing to guarantee they meet strict specifications.
  • Train customers on operating equipment, encouraging a collaborative and inclusive environment.
  • Respond promptly to service calls, addressing equipment failures and faults with proven expertise.
  • Identify and tackle problems as they arise, ensuring minimal disruption to operations.
What We Are Looking For
  • High School diploma or equivalent experience required; an Associate’s degree or vocational technical training is preferred.
  • Specialized skill training/certification is highly valued.
  • Senior-level knowledge with 5-7 years of experience in a technical or specialty area.
  • Proven track record in the area of responsibility, demonstrating successful completion of key tasks.
  • Outstanding ability to maintain professional communications with onsite customer leadership, Dematic leadership, and technicians.
  • Experience in leading projects, teams, and advising day-to-day operations and tasks for the onsite maintenance team.
  • Physical capability to lift and move materials up to 50 pounds, with regular bending, lifting, stretching, and reaching.
  • Ability to occasionally push and pull wheeled dollies loaded with products up to 100 pounds.
  • Proficiency in safely climbing ladders and gangways.
  • Ability to work in different conditions: small spaces, dust, fumes, heat/cold, noise, vibration, and wet surfaces.
